Reuell Walters was once at Tottenham
Walters is naturally a right-back but can also play as a centre-half. He joined Arsenal as an under-16 player and has impressed massively since.
However, what many may not know is that the now-17-year-old was once a part of Tottenham’s academy.
Walters spent four years at Spurs and was really impressive there as well. Tottenham offered him a new two-year deal to keep hold of him, but the youngster, along with his dad, decided that he needed a break from academy football.
After nearly two years away, he joined Arsenal, and if he continues his growth, it’s only a matter of time before he becomes a household name in an around North London.
